POWER IMBALANCES IN SEXUAL ENCOUNTERS: EXAMINING THE EFFECTS ON GENDER ROLES AND SATISFACTION LEVELS enIT FR DE PL TR PT RU JA CN ES

Power imbalance is the unequal distribution of resources, status, and influence between individuals or groups within a society. In the context of sex, it refers to the disparity in power dynamics between men and women, which can impact their behavior during sexual encounters. This phenomenon often manifests itself through the expectation that men take on a dominant role while women assume the submissive position.

Men are expected to initiate sex, whereas women must be passive participants who follow the male's desires. Such expectations reinforce traditional gender roles and stereotypes, leading to limited opportunities for exploring different types of sexual experiences.

The prevalence of power imbalances in modern societies contributes to sexual objectification, whereby one partner views the other solely as an object of pleasure instead of treating them as an equal participant in the act. The imbalanced power dynamics result in men dominating the conversation and decision-making process regarding sexual activities, leaving women feeling helpless and unable to express their needs and preferences effectively. Men may also feel pressure to perform well and achieve orgasm quickly, resulting in unsatisfying encounters for both parties.

Power imbalances reinforce gendered expectations by perpetuating the notion that men should pursue sexual gratification at all costs, leading to situations where they ignore their partners' boundaries or engage in risky behavior without considering the consequences. On the other hand, women may feel guilty about rejecting sexual advances or setting limits due to cultural norms that prioritize pleasing their partners over their own well-being. These dynamics create a vicious cycle that traps individuals in rigid gender roles and prevents meaningful communication and intimacy from developing within relationships.

To overcome these issues, society must work towards creating a more equitable power balance between men and women. This can involve addressing systemic barriers that prevent women from achieving economic parity with men, promoting education on healthy sexual practices, and providing resources for individuals to explore alternative expressions of desire and identity outside traditional norms. By doing so, we can foster a culture where people are free to express themselves sexually without fear or judgment and enjoy fulfilling, consensual experiences.
